Output 496c23c286503ecef4b419ebc795090206b5f76c1498cb5660347c0e40c1c4cc:9

value
24356933
script pubkey
OP_0 OP_PUSHBYTES_20 51cd273882a73d25c5581dc615fe9dcba05e4724
address
bc1q28xjwwyz5u7jt32crhrptl5aews9u3eyh6jvah
transaction
496c23c286503ecef4b419ebc795090206b5f76c1498cb5660347c0e40c1c4cc
spent
true